Pipeline TD

London

As a Pipeline Technical Director (Pipeline TD), you will be responsible for ensuring the smooth running of the tools, software and workflows used on our award-winning VFX and Feature Animation shows. You will be providing face-to-face technical support and assistance to artists, as well as developing new tools and scripts - predominantly in Python - to meet the specific show requirements.

Our talented Pipeline TDs are highly technical and demonstrate an aptitude for creative problem solving. You will be regularly required to:
* Provide technical advice and support for artists
* Collaborate with R&D developers and senior production supervisors to develop specific new Python tools and workflows
* Contribute to the development and constant improvement of the DNEG pipeline
* Ensure requests for new tools are connected with company strategy
* As well as being able to demonstrate technical skill and initiative, you will need to be an excellent communicator - your ability to accurately and succinctly communicate between technical developers and non-technical artists will help you thrive in this role.

Our Pipeline TDs not only produce excellent work, they are also inspirational mentors and coaches to the more junior members of the Pipeline team. This ranges from formal guidance - generating tutorials and teaching materials - to informal mentoring on a day-to-day basis, and you will be supported in this role by our Pipeline Supervisors.

Above all, you will be at the centre of some of the most exciting VFX and Animation work on projects ranging from blockbuster epics to television dramas, working with some of the most talented individuals in the industry. You will be in a fantastic position to develop your leadership skills and enhance your skills as a tool developer in a collaborative, show-facing environment.

Must have:
* Previous experience in Visual Effects or a related industry
* Excellent Python, Maya and Linux skills
* Solid understanding of the Visual Effects pipeline
* Experience in developing tools for DCC packages such as Houdini, Maya or Nuke

Nice to have:
* A degree in Computer Science, Computer Graphics or other related field
* Experience with source control systems and team development
